The Tomb of Hoshang Sha, Mandu: A Monumental Testament to Historical Grandeur Nestled amidst the tranquil landscape of Mandu, in the Madhya Pradesh Province of India, lies the magnificent Tomb of Hoshang Sha. This architectural marvel, captured in this evocative photograph by Ralph Ponsonby Watts, is a poignant reminder of the rich historical heritage of India. The Tomb, believed to have been built in the late 15th century, is a funerary monument dedicated to Hoshang Sha, the companion and chief minister of Sultan Ghiyasuddin Muhammad Shah of the Malwa Sultanate. The monument's grandeur is a testament to the opulence and power of the Malwa Sultanate during that period. The Tomb is characterized by its impressive dome, which is a common feature of Indo-Islamic architecture. The dome, adorned with intricate carvings and calligraphy, is a visual feast for the eyes. The tomb complex also includes a mosque, a pavilion, and a tank, reflecting the holistic approach to architecture during that era. The Tomb of Hoshang Sha is not just a mortuary structure but a living monument that continues to inspire awe and admiration. Its intricate designs, symmetrical layout, and harmonious blend of Indian and Islamic architectural elements make it a must-visit destination for history buffs, architecture enthusiasts, and travelers seeking a glimpse into India's rich cultural heritage.
